Businessman tries to get from New York to Chicago and is thwarted at every turn, invariably by John Candy. Absolutely hysterical comedy from John Hughes with Martin playing it straight. Ending is a bit much on the holiday spirit thing, but the set pieces are up there with Airplane! ~ The Sloth

Utterly brilliant movie from start to end, and anyone who doesn't feel sorry for Candy in that penultimate scene in the train station where he makes that confession to Martin, isn't human. ~ The Lord
